Main series is turn based RPGs. You control up to three medarot, each have three attacks depending on the parts you equip it with. It's kind of like Pokemon in the sense that you collect all sorts of different medarots, parts and medal and level them up.
Second game introduced Medaforce, a special attack you need to charge up and is good for last resort attacks when all your parts are already broken. Third game introduced transforming Medarot so you had more attack options aswell.
Most enemies are fairly easy but sometimes your'e gonna need some thinking ahead. Like which part to use on that specific Medarot, what not to use and so on.
Spin-offs include several actions games and one SRPG on the GBA.

Okawara's style is typically a clean and simple approach. His work is usually boxy, like the Gundam or Daitarn 3. The only MS with clear German soldier design asthetics are the Geara Zulu and the Zaku II Fz B type head.
Neither of these two Mobile Suits were deisgned by Okawara, The Zulu was designed by Hajime Katoki, known for his work on the Gundam Wing EW suit designs.
Yutaka Izubuchi designed the Fz. And originally it was meant to be the Zaku II. But it got backlashed, it was salvaged by being turned into a late OYW Zaku II variant that became a by-product of the united maintenance plan.

Carnage Heart is really fucking good. It has a lot of aspects to it so it's fairly hard to explain.
As other anon said: You build and program mechs to fight other mechs. Programming is done with linkchaining modules so it doesn't go full AUTIS-100, but the system allows insanely complex designs.
Give it a try, there really is pretty much nothing like it.
Shit gets real in EXA when you unlock intermech communication and start adding dynamic tactics changes.
